Curious to know what the movie's about? Here's the plot: "Favouritism towards lighter skin tones is embedded in the Indian psyche and Tamil cinema is no exception. Through conversations with industry professionals, artistes, social activists and the common people, this documentary examines the history and practice of differential treatment based on skin colour, especially regarding actresses in Tamil cinema." .
